Guillem Balague says Barcelona will return with an €80m (£71m) bid for Philippe Coutinho in January, plus five more things from this weekend's La Liga action...

The Sky Sports Spanish football expert returns with his weekly column and kicks off with an update on Liverpool star Coutinho.

Balague also discusses Luis Suarez's slump at Barcelona, Atletico Madrid's back-to-basics approach and Leganes' unlikely rise...

Coutinho saga to rumble on...

If you ask most people they will agree it doesn't make much sense for Liverpool to sell Coutinho in January but Barcelona will still try.

They will put about €80m (£71m) on the table and will look to test Liverpool's resolve. Barca feel the conditions are still there for the player to leave - they think he will still be very useful to them considering the departure of Neymar as he has not been replaced.

Remember Barca did not want Coutinho until they started to use him as a way to keep Neymar from PSG. Once Neymar left they realised he could fill that gap anyway.

This transfer now enters the phase of wait and see what happens in January. Barca will bid €80m, it's just for Liverpool to decide. Has their resolve softened? Or will they stay strong again like the summer?
